A short, single-stranded DNA or RNA tagged with radioactive molecule to detect the complementary strand is called probe. A short, double DNA tagged with radioactive thimidine for recognising its corresponding complementary strand is not a probe.

Proto-oncogenes are normal cellular genes that, when activated by mutation, contribute towards the malignant phenotype. Gene amplification is a mechanism of proto-oncogene activation.

These plasmids are used for reducing the expression of endogenous genes. This is often attained through the expression of an shRNA while targeting the mRNA of the gene of interest. These plasmids possess promoters that can influence the expression of short RNAs.
